Technical description<br />

- Impeller material: Hot <strong>air</strong> impeller of stainless steel<br />

- Direction of rotation: Right, looking at <strong>hot</strong> <strong>air</strong> impeller<br />

- Bearings: Maintenance-free ball bearings<br />

- Electrical connection: Terminal strip
